Skip to content

ROX-26889: Build main source image without Cachi2 artifact#13238

Merged
msugakov merged 2 commits intomasterfrom
misha/no-main-cachi2-sources-konflux
Nov 7, 2024
Merged

ROX-26889: Build main source image without Cachi2 artifact#13238
msugakov merged 2 commits intomasterfrom
misha/no-main-cachi2-sources-konflux

Conversation

@msugakov
Copy link
Contributor

@msugakov msugakov commented Nov 6, 2024

Description

As a workaround for https://issues.redhat.com/browse/KFLUXBUGS-1508

User-facing documentation

  • CHANGELOG is updated OR update is not needed
  • documentation PR is created and is linked above OR is not needed

Testing and quality

  • the change is production ready: the change is GA or otherwise the functionality is gated by a feature flag
  • CI results are inspected

Automated testing

No contributions to automated tests.

How I validated my change

There's a chance Konflux EC won't be happy with the image, I'd request policy exception as part of the same task ROX-26889

@openshift-ci
Copy link

openshift-ci bot commented Nov 6, 2024

Skipping CI for Draft Pull Request.
If you want CI signal for your change, please convert it to an actual PR.
You can still manually trigger a test run with /test all

@msugakov msugakov changed the title Build main source without Cachi2 artifact Build main source image without Cachi2 artifact Nov 6, 2024
@rhacs-bot
Copy link
Contributor

rhacs-bot commented Nov 6, 2024

Images are ready for the commit at c04c28f.

To use with deploy scripts, first export MAIN_IMAGE_TAG=4.7.x-57-gc04c28fef7.

@codecov
Copy link

codecov bot commented Nov 6, 2024

Codecov Report

All modified and coverable lines are covered by tests ✅

Project coverage is 48.50%. Comparing base (2d37fc2) to head (587d80f).

Additional details and impacted files
@@            Coverage Diff             @@
##           master   #13238      +/-   ##
==========================================
- Coverage   48.50%   48.50%   -0.01%     
==========================================
  Files        2468     2468              
  Lines      178011   178011              
==========================================
- Hits        86347    86344       -3     
- Misses      84731    84734       +3     
  Partials     6933     6933              
Flag Coverage Δ
go-unit-tests 48.50% <ø> (-0.01%) ⬇️

Flags with carried forward coverage won't be shown. Click here to find out more.

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

@msugakov
Copy link
Contributor Author

msugakov commented Nov 6, 2024

/retest main-on-push

@stackrox stackrox deleted a comment from openshift-ci bot Nov 6, 2024
@msugakov
Copy link
Contributor Author

msugakov commented Nov 6, 2024

/test main-on-push

1 similar comment
@msugakov
Copy link
Contributor Author

msugakov commented Nov 6, 2024

/test main-on-push

@stackrox stackrox deleted a comment from openshift-ci bot Nov 6, 2024
@stackrox stackrox deleted a comment from openshift-ci bot Nov 6, 2024
@msugakov msugakov force-pushed the misha/no-main-cachi2-sources-konflux branch from fb36db0 to 587d80f Compare November 6, 2024 17:37
@msugakov msugakov changed the title Build main source image without Cachi2 artifact ROX-26889: Build main source image without Cachi2 artifact Nov 6, 2024
@msugakov
Copy link
Contributor Author

msugakov commented Nov 6, 2024

/test main-on-push

@openshift-ci

This comment was marked as outdated.

@msugakov msugakov force-pushed the misha/no-main-cachi2-sources-konflux branch from 587d80f to c04c28f Compare November 7, 2024 10:02
@msugakov msugakov added the backport-for-4.6-konflux-release https://redhat-internal.slack.com/archives/C05TS9N0S7L/p1730134914487439 label Nov 7, 2024
@msugakov msugakov marked this pull request as ready for review November 7, 2024 10:04
@msugakov msugakov requested a review from a team as a code owner November 7, 2024 10:04
@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

For the local run of ec CLI, I get only a few of

✕ [Violation] slsa_source_correlated.source_code_reference_provided
  ImageRef: quay.io/rhacs-eng/main@sha256:d9d0ace3d7fb5d3effe6ce2497b8fa58ad1e7f874dbb28c397115d6e14e559ba
  Reason: Expected source code reference was not provided for verification

which could be a red herring.

@msugakov msugakov requested a review from tommartensen November 7, 2024 10:40
@openshift-ci
Copy link

openshift-ci bot commented Nov 7, 2024

@msugakov: The following tests failed, say /retest to rerun all failed tests or /retest-required to rerun all mandatory failed tests:

Test name Commit Details Required Rerun command
ci/prow/ocp-4-17-nongroovy-e2e-tests c04c28f link false /test ocp-4-17-nongroovy-e2e-tests
ci/prow/ocp-4-12-nongroovy-e2e-tests c04c28f link false /test ocp-4-12-nongroovy-e2e-tests
ci/prow/gke-sensor-integration-tests c04c28f link false /test gke-sensor-integration-tests

Full PR test history. Your PR dashboard.

Details

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here.

@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

/test main-on-push

@stackrox stackrox deleted a comment from openshift-ci bot Nov 7, 2024
@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

/test acs-enterprise-contract / main

@stackrox stackrox deleted a comment from openshift-ci bot Nov 7, 2024
@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

/test main-on-push

@openshift-ci

This comment was marked as outdated.

@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

/test main-on-push

@stackrox stackrox deleted a comment from openshift-ci bot Nov 7, 2024
@msugakov
Copy link
Contributor Author

msugakov commented Nov 7, 2024

I'm going to merge it now and catch up with EC results after. Will keep the task open for that.

@msugakov msugakov merged commit e4bcdff into master Nov 7, 2024
@msugakov msugakov deleted the misha/no-main-cachi2-sources-konflux branch November 7, 2024 18: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port-for-4.6-konflux-release https://redhat-internal.slack.com/archives/C05TS9N0S7L/p1730134914487439

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ants